At this rate, we estimate the total cost of tuition and fees for two years at … WebAt Everglades U, approximately 54% of students took out student loans averaging $6,691 a year. That adds up to $26,764 over four years for those students. The student loan default rate at Everglades U is 11.8%. This is higher than the national default rate of 10.1% so you should proceed with caution when taking out student loans.

Financial Aid Packages Vary From Year to Year Many … WebAt Everglades University, 66.0% of incoming students take out a loan to help defray freshman year costs, averaging $6,232 a piece. This amount includes both private and federally-funded student loans. The average federal loan is $5,587, which is 101.6% of the first-year borrowing cap of $5,500* for the typical first-year dependent student.
